Q: Is 118,743,388 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 118,743,388 is a composite number.

Why is 118,743,388 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 118,743,388 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 19 23 38 46 76 92 437 874 1,748 67,931 135,862 271,724 1,290,689 1,562,413 2,581,378 3,124,826 5,162,756 6,249,652 29,685,847 59,371,694 and 118,743,388, with no remainder.

Since 118,743,388 cannot be divided by just 1 and 118,743,388, it is a composite number.
